%% Copyright (c) 2026, Benoit Chesneau. %% Licensed under the Apache License, Version 2.0. %% %% @doc HTTP/3 WebTransport protocol helpers. %% %% This module bridges the generic HTTP/3 connection layer from quic_h3 %% with WebTransport-specific session negotiation and capsule handling. %% -module(wt_h3). -export([default_settings/0, default_settings/1]). -export([request_headers/2, request_headers/3, request_headers/4]). -export([request_session/4, request_session/5]). -export([response_status/1, is_success_response/1]). -export([validate_wt_support/2, validate_wt_support/3]). -export([detect_compat_mode/1]). -export([send_capsule/3, close_session/4, drain_session/2]). -include("webtransport.hrl"). -type headers() :: [{binary(), binary()}]. -type compat_mode() :: latest | legacy_browser_compat. -export_type([headers/0, compat_mode/0]). %% ============================================================================ %% Settings %% ============================================================================ %% @deprecated Use `default_settings/1' with an explicit `compat_mode'. %% Retained for the eunit suite and external callers that haven't migrated. %% Returns the latest-spec settings. -spec default_settings() -> map(). default_settings() -> default_settings(latest). %% @doc Return default H3 settings for the given compatibility mode. -spec default_settings(compat_mode()) -> map(). default_settings(latest) -> %% draft-15 §3.1: servers advertise wt_enabled plus initial %% flow-control windows. h3_datagram (0x33) is emitted by quic_h3 %% when `h3_datagram_enabled => true' -- don't duplicate it here %% (duplicate setting ids are an H3_SETTINGS_ERROR per %% RFC 9114 §7.2.4.1). #{ enable_connect_protocol => 1, wt_enabled => 1, wt_initial_max_data => ?DEFAULT_MAX_DATA, wt_initial_max_streams_bidi => ?DEFAULT_MAX_STREAMS_BIDI, wt_initial_max_streams_uni => ?DEFAULT_MAX_STREAMS_UNI }; default_settings(legacy_browser_compat) -> %% draft-02 (Chrome / Firefox / quic-go v0.9). Never mix these %% with the latest-spec settings in one handshake. #{ enable_connect_protocol => 1, ?SETTINGS_ENABLE_WEBTRANSPORT_DRAFT02 => 1 }. %% ============================================================================ %% Session Establishment %% ============================================================================ %% @doc Build WebTransport CONNECT request headers for the latest draft. -spec request_headers(binary(), binary()) -> headers(). request_headers(Authority, Path) -> request_headers(Authority, Path, [], latest). %% @doc Build WebTransport CONNECT request headers with additional custom headers. -spec request_headers(binary(), binary(), headers()) -> headers(). request_headers(Authority, Path, ExtraHeaders) -> request_headers(Authority, Path, ExtraHeaders, latest). %% @doc Build WebTransport CONNECT request headers for the specified compat mode. -spec request_headers(binary(), binary(), headers(), compat_mode()) -> headers(). request_headers(Authority, Path, ExtraHeaders, latest) -> %% draft-15 §3.2: `:protocol' MUST be `webtransport-h3'. No draft-02 %% Sec- header on this path. BaseHeaders = [ {<<":method">>, <<"CONNECT">>}, {<<":protocol">>, <<"webtransport-h3">>}, {<<":scheme">>, <<"https">>}, {<<":authority">>, Authority}, {<<":path">>, Path} ], BaseHeaders ++ strip_reserved_headers(ExtraHeaders); request_headers(Authority, Path, ExtraHeaders, legacy_browser_compat) -> %% draft-02: `:protocol' = webtransport + the draft-02 marker header. %% Chrome / Firefox / quic-go v0.9 expect this exact shape. BaseHeaders = [ {<<":method">>, <<"CONNECT">>}, {<<":protocol">>, <<"webtransport">>}, {<<":scheme">>, <<"https">>}, {<<":authority">>, Authority}, {<<":path">>, Path}, {<<"sec-webtransport-http3-draft02">>, <<"1">>} ], BaseHeaders ++ strip_reserved_headers(ExtraHeaders). %% @doc Send a WebTransport CONNECT request on the H3 connection, returning the stream ID. -spec request_session(pid(), binary(), binary(), headers()) -> {ok, non_neg_integer()} | {error, term()}. request_session(H3Conn, Authority, Path, ExtraHeaders) -> request_session(H3Conn, Authority, Path, ExtraHeaders, latest). %% @doc Send a WebTransport CONNECT request using the given compat mode. -spec request_session(pid(), binary(), binary(), headers(), compat_mode()) -> {ok, non_neg_integer()} | {error, term()}. request_session(H3Conn, Authority, Path, ExtraHeaders, CompatMode) -> Headers = request_headers(Authority, Path, ExtraHeaders, CompatMode), quic_h3:request(H3Conn, Headers, #{end_stream => false}). %% @doc Extract the numeric HTTP status code from response headers. -spec response_status(headers()) -> {ok, non_neg_integer()} | {error, term()}. response_status(Headers) -> case lists:keyfind(<<":status">>, 1, Headers) of {_, StatusBin} when is_binary(StatusBin) -> try {ok, binary_to_integer(StatusBin)} catch error:badarg -> {error, {invalid_status, StatusBin}} end; false -> {error, missing_status} end. %% @doc Return true if the response headers contain a 2xx status code. -spec is_success_response(headers()) -> boolean(). is_success_response(Headers) -> case response_status(Headers) of {ok, Status} when Status >= 200, Status < 300 -> true; _ -> false end. %% ============================================================================ %% Peer Validation %% ============================================================================ %% @doc Check that the peer advertises WebTransport support (latest draft). -spec validate_wt_support(pid(), pid()) -> ok | {error, term()}. validate_wt_support(H3Conn, QuicConn) -> validate_wt_support(H3Conn, QuicConn, latest). %% @doc Check that the peer advertises WebTransport support for the given compat mode. -spec validate_wt_support(pid(), pid(), compat_mode()) -> ok | {error, term()}. validate_wt_support(H3Conn, QuicConn, CompatMode) -> case quic_h3:get_peer_settings(H3Conn) of undefined -> {error, settings_not_received}; PeerSettings -> case validate_required_settings(PeerSettings, CompatMode) of ok -> validate_transport_params(QuicConn); Err -> Err end end. validate_transport_params(QuicConn) -> case quic:get_peer_transport_params(QuicConn) of {ok, TP} -> case maps:get(max_datagram_frame_size, TP, 0) of 0 -> {error, datagrams_not_enabled}; _ -> %% reset_stream_at is required by draft-15 §3.1. %% If the peer does not advertise it, warn but allow %% (many implementations have not adopted it yet). case maps:get(reset_stream_at, TP, false) of true -> ok; false -> logger:debug("peer does not advertise reset_stream_at"), ok end end; {error, _} -> %% Transport params not yet available (rare race). ok end. validate_required_settings(PeerSettings, CompatMode) -> case setting_enabled(PeerSettings, enable_connect_protocol) of false -> {error, connect_protocol_not_enabled}; true -> check_wt_setting(PeerSettings, CompatMode) end. check_wt_setting(PeerSettings, latest) -> %% draft-15 §3.1: peer MUST advertise wt_enabled = 1. case setting_enabled(PeerSettings, wt_enabled) of true -> ok; false -> {error, wt_not_enabled} end; check_wt_setting(PeerSettings, legacy_browser_compat) -> case maps:find(?SETTINGS_ENABLE_WEBTRANSPORT_DRAFT02, PeerSettings) of {ok, V} when V =/= 0 -> ok; _ -> {error, wt_not_enabled} end. setting_enabled(Settings, Key) -> Value = maps:get(Key, Settings, 0), Value =:= 1 orelse Value =:= true. %% Server-side helper: read the incoming CONNECT request and decide which %% compat mode it is asking for. Returns `{ok, latest | legacy_browser_compat}' %% on a well-formed request or `{error, Reason}' if the three signals %% disagree. %% @doc Determine the compat mode (latest or legacy) from incoming CONNECT headers. -spec detect_compat_mode(headers()) -> {ok, compat_mode()} | {error, term()}. detect_compat_mode(Headers) -> Protocol = header_value(<<":protocol">>, Headers), Draft02Marker = header_value(<<"sec-webtransport-http3-draft02">>, Headers), case {Protocol, Draft02Marker} of {<<"webtransport-h3">>, undefined} -> {ok, latest}; {<<"webtransport-h3">>, _} -> %% Sending the draft-02 marker alongside the draft-15 :protocol %% is not a valid handshake. {error, mixed_draft_signals}; {<<"webtransport">>, _} -> %% draft-02. Some implementations (webtransport-go) do not send %% the `Sec-Webtransport-Http3-Draft02' header; treat the %% :protocol alone as sufficient evidence of draft-02 intent. {ok, legacy_browser_compat}; {undefined, _} -> {error, missing_protocol}; {_, _} -> {error, unknown_protocol} end. header_value(Name, Headers) -> case lists:keyfind(Name, 1, Headers) of {_, Value} -> Value; false -> undefined end. %% ============================================================================ %% CONNECT Stream Capsules %% ============================================================================ %% @doc Encode and send a capsule on the CONNECT stream for the given session. -spec send_capsule(pid(), non_neg_integer(), wt_h3_capsule:capsule()) -> ok | {error, term()}. send_capsule(H3Conn, SessionId, Capsule) -> quic_h3:send_data(H3Conn, SessionId, wt_h3_capsule:encode(Capsule), false). %% @doc Send a CLOSE_WEBTRANSPORT_SESSION capsule on the CONNECT stream. -spec close_session(pid(), non_neg_integer(), non_neg_integer(), binary()) -> ok | {error, term()}. close_session(H3Conn, SessionId, ErrorCode, Reason) -> send_capsule(H3Conn, SessionId, wt_h3_capsule:close_session(ErrorCode, Reason)). %% @doc Send a DRAIN_WEBTRANSPORT_SESSION capsule to signal graceful shutdown. -spec drain_session(pid(), non_neg_integer()) -> ok | {error, term()}. drain_session(H3Conn, SessionId) -> send_capsule(H3Conn, SessionId, wt_h3_capsule:drain_session()). strip_reserved_headers(Headers) -> Reserved = #{ <<":method">> => true, <<":protocol">> => true, <<":scheme">> => true, <<":authority">> => true, <<":path">> => true }, [ {Name, Value} || {Name, Value} <- Headers, not maps:is_key(Name, Reserved) ]. -ifdef(TEST). -include_lib("eunit/include/eunit.hrl"). request_headers_latest_test() -> Headers = request_headers(<<"example.com">>, <<"/wt">>, [{<<"origin">>, <<"https://example.com">>}], latest), ?assertEqual({<<":method">>, <<"CONNECT">>}, lists:nth(1, Headers)), ?assert(lists:member({<<":protocol">>, <<"webtransport-h3">>}, Headers)), ?assertNot(lists:keymember(<<"sec-webtransport-http3-draft02">>, 1, Headers)), ?assert(lists:member({<<"origin">>, <<"https://example.com">>}, Headers)). request_headers_legacy_test() -> Headers = request_headers(<<"example.com">>, <<"/wt">>, [], legacy_browser_compat), ?assert(lists:member({<<":protocol">>, <<"webtransport">>}, Headers)), ?assert(lists:member({<<"sec-webtransport-http3-draft02">>, <<"1">>}, Headers)). default_settings_latest_disjoint_from_legacy_test() -> Latest = default_settings(latest), Legacy = default_settings(legacy_browser_compat), ?assert(maps:is_key(wt_enabled, Latest)), ?assertNot(maps:is_key(?SETTINGS_ENABLE_WEBTRANSPORT_DRAFT02, Latest)), ?assert(maps:is_key(?SETTINGS_ENABLE_WEBTRANSPORT_DRAFT02, Legacy)), ?assertNot(maps:is_key(wt_enabled, Legacy)). detect_compat_mode_latest_test() -> ?assertEqual({ok, latest}, detect_compat_mode([{<<":protocol">>, <<"webtransport-h3">>}])). detect_compat_mode_legacy_test() -> ?assertEqual({ok, legacy_browser_compat}, detect_compat_mode([{<<":protocol">>, <<"webtransport">>}, {<<"sec-webtransport-http3-draft02">>, <<"1">>}])). detect_compat_mode_bare_legacy_test() -> %% webtransport-go v0.9 sends `:protocol = webtransport' without the %% draft-02 Sec- header; we still recognize it as legacy. ?assertEqual({ok, legacy_browser_compat}, detect_compat_mode([{<<":protocol">>, <<"webtransport">>}])). detect_compat_mode_rejects_mixed_test() -> ?assertEqual({error, mixed_draft_signals}, detect_compat_mode([{<<":protocol">>, <<"webtransport-h3">>}, {<<"sec-webtransport-http3-draft02">>, <<"1">>}])). response_status_test_() -> [ ?_assertEqual({ok, 200}, response_status([{<<":status">>, <<"200">>}])), ?_assert(is_success_response([{<<":status">>, <<"204">>}])), ?_assertNot(is_success_response([{<<":status">>, <<"404">>}])) ]. -endif.
